Math Problem Statement

In kilometers, how many times larger is the diameter of the observable universe compared to the generally accepted diameter of our solar system?

Solution

The diameter of the observable universe is approximately 93 billion light-years, which can be converted to kilometers. The generally accepted diameter of our solar system (defined by the extent of the Oort Cloud) is about 2 light-years.

Steps to find how many times larger the observable universe is:

  1. Convert light-years to kilometers:

    • 1 light-year ≈ 9.461 × 10¹² km.
  2. Diameter of the observable universe:

    = 8.8 \times 10^{23} \, \text{km}$$
  3. Diameter of the solar system:

    = 1.892 \times 10^{13} \, \text{km}$$
  4. Ratio (how many times larger the observable universe is): 8.8×1023km1.892×1013km4.65×1010\frac{8.8 \times 10^{23} \, \text{km}}{1.892 \times 10^{13} \, \text{km}} \approx 4.65 \times 10^{10}

Conclusion:

The diameter of the observable universe is about 46.5 billion times larger than the diameter of the solar system.
